The Arizona Green Party (AZGP) is the officially recognized affiliate of the Green Party in the state of Arizona. It was founded by Carolyn Campbell alongside others in the 1990s. Cody Hannah, whose term expires January 2026, serves as Co-Chairperson of the Arizona Green Party.[1]
